From 0f985dcb1978afd4b383116f01b3acf65c39ecd7 Mon Sep 17 00:00:00 2001 From: Jeremy Allison Date: Sun, 9 Apr 2006 19:39:38 +0000 Subject: r15012: Fix bug #2715. Fix suggested by ISHIKAWA Tomonori No need to null terminate early, pull_ascii_fstring will do this. Jeremy. (This used to be commit b1bbe568313001f4b4e49382742e4b819c0a2b03) --- source3/nmbd/nmbd_incomingdgrams.c | 2 -- 1 file changed, 2 deletions(-) diff --git a/source3/nmbd/nmbd_incomingdgrams.c b/source3/nmbd/nmbd_incomingdgrams.c index 53b1947157..09eb7bfa86 100644 --- a/source3/nmbd/nmbd_incomingdgrams.c +++ b/source3/nmbd/nmbd_incomingdgrams.c @@ -108,7 +108,6 @@ void process_host_announce(struct subnet_record *subrec, struct packet_struct *p START_PROFILE(host_announce); pull_ascii_fstring(comment, buf+31); - comment[42] = 0; pull_ascii_nstring(announce_name, sizeof(announce_name), buf+5); pull_ascii_nstring(source_name, sizeof(source_name), dgram->source_name.name); @@ -267,7 +266,6 @@ void process_local_master_announce(struct subnet_record *subrec, struct packet_s pull_ascii_nstring(server_name,sizeof(server_name),buf+5); pull_ascii_fstring(comment, buf+31); - comment[42] = 0; pull_ascii_nstring(source_name, sizeof(source_name), dgram->source_name.name); pull_ascii_nstring(work_name, sizeof(work_name), dgram->dest_name.name); -- cgit